Phlebotomist Training and Criteria

It is important to cover all the specifications to become a Phlebotomy Technician before starting your training. You have to meet the legal age limit, as well as having a high school diploma or equivalent, pass a drug test and pass a criminal background screening.

What You Need to Know in Phlebotomy Courses

So, have you reached the spot where you need to choose which Phlebotomy training meet your needs? As soon as you begin your search, you can find a wide selection of training programs, but what exactly do you have to watch out for when deciding on certified phlebotomist? It’s heavily recommended that you make certain you verify that the school or program you’re considering is recognized by the Kentucky State Board or some other governing organization. Right after verifying the accreditation situation, you will want to search a bit further to be certain that the training program you are considering can provide you with the proper training.

  • Double check that the courses satisfies at least the minimal specifications
  • Overall performance of alumni on the certification exam over the past five years
  • Credentials of course instructors
